refactor command flow and add signed package/hook safety

- split CLI definitions and command execution out of main.rs into new cli.rs and commands.rs modules\n- add transaction hook support via /etc/depot.d/hooks/*.toml with pre/post phases, operation/package/path filters, wildcard negation, and optional affected-path stdin\n- execute transaction hooks around install/update/remove operations and add package-action prompts for install/build/remove flows\n- require and verify detached minisign signatures for binary package archives when allow_unsigned=false, including cache handling and tests\n- persist optional dependencies from package metadata into repo index data and include optional deps in produced metadata\n- update dependency/planner logic to ignore dependencies provided by local split outputs and stop pulling test deps into install planning\n- auto-disable tests when required test dependencies are missing instead of hard-failing build/install paths\n- improve autotools defaults by injecting standard install directory flags when supported and preserving user overrides\n- remove static .a archives during staging by default with new build.flags.no_delete_static escape hatch\n- preserve symlinks and file metadata (permissions/timestamps) in extractor fallback copy path and add regression tests\n- refresh README docs for detached package signatures, optional dependencies, and transaction hooks\n- adjust dependency set: add filetime, disable reqwest default features, and simplify git2/OpenSSL linkage

fn default_configure_install_dirs(
flags: &crate::package::BuildFlags,
help_text: Option<&str>,
) -> Vec<String> {
let libdir = if flags.lib32_variant {
"/usr/lib32"
} else {
"/usr/lib"
};
let bindir = nonempty_trimmed(&flags.bindir).unwrap_or("/usr/bin");
let defaults = [
("--bindir", bindir),
("--sbindir", "/usr/bin"),
("--libdir", libdir),
("--libexecdir", libdir),
("--sysconfdir", "/etc"),
("--localstatedir", "/var"),
("--sharedstatedir", "/var/lib"),
("--includedir", "/usr/include"),
("--datarootdir", "/usr/share"),
("--datadir", "/usr/share"),
("--mandir", "/usr/share/man"),
("--infodir", "/usr/share/info"),
];
defaults
.iter()
.filter(|(option, _)| {
help_text.is_some_and(|text| configure_help_supports_option(text, option))
})
.filter(|(option, _)| !has_configure_option_prefix(&flags.configure, option))
.map(|(option, value)| format!("{option}={value}"))
.collect()
}
